Safety is a very important factor as far as welding and other such activities are concerned. Safety becomes every more important where you are performing welding at a height or where you are performing overhead welding using a stick welder.

The first and most important safety accessory that you need is a welding helmet. This becomes even more important when you are performing overhead welding. The sparks are going to rain down and your hair and head will be burned to a frazzle if you do not use protection of a welding helmet.

Further, there always is the possibility of a fall when performing overhead welding. These accidents can take place suddenly and the onus is upon you to protect yourself from the fall. A good quality welding helmet will you remain safe from not just the sparks but also from the impact of a fall.

Apart from the welding helmet, you will need good quality clothing accessories to ensure your arms; legs and torso do not suffer from any burns. Wearing loose clothing is a strict no-no as a stray spark may enter your clothes and singe your body. The sensation of a sudden burn inside your clothes on your chest or neck can be very disconcerting. It is common for individuals to lose balance and fall off their perch when this happens. Wearing a welding helmet will ensure only minimum damage takes place.

Many experts suggest that an individual undertaking overhead welding must wear a leather jacket over a thick cloth like denim. This ensures that the skin is totally safe from the sparks.

Pay special attention to the quality of glasses used during overhead welding. This may seem like a small point but make sure the welding helmet as well as the glass fit you comfortably. Many a times, the size of the glasses prevents the welding helmet from fitting perfectly. Do not compromise on comfort or fit when undertaking hazardous tasks.
